Bank of America, founded in 1904 as the Bank of Italy by Amadeo Giannini to serve immigrants in San Francisco, is now one of the largest financial institutions in the world, head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, following its 1998 merger with NationsBank. It provides a broad spectrum of services, including consumer banking, wealth management (through its Merrill division), commercial banking, and investment banking, managing trillions in assets and serving millions of customers globally.

Bank of America's Q3 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2019, Bank of America held 7,810 positions worth $673B, up 1.8% from $661B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Bank of America's Q3 2019 filing shows 469 new, 3,367 increased, 2,993 reduced and 379 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Genmab: 931,881 shares worth $18.9M. The largest sale was Automatic Data Processing, an estimated $1.45B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 9.3% of assets, down from 9.9%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
